The “balloon boy” story popped wide open on Sunday when the Colorado sheriff who had been investigating the incident held a press conference stating the whole thing was a hoax. “It was a publicity stunt,” Larimer County Sherriff Jim Alderden told reporters, “and we believe we have evidence to indicate that this was a publicity stunt in hopes to better market themselves for a reality show.” The Heene family, whose son Falcon was said to be inside an out-of-control weather balloon that floated above northern Colorado for several hours on Friday, could face several charges, including conspiracy, contributing to the delinquency of a minor, filing a false report, and attempting to influence a public servant. The Heenes, one-time participants in the ABC television show Wife Swap, have emphatically denied that the incident was a hoax, despite accusations from father Richard’s former assistant.
